WebHá 1 dia · Three-phase motors operate by the principle of electromagnetic induction which was discovered by the English physicist Michael Faraday back in 1830. Faraday noticed that when a conductor such as a coil or loop of wire, is placed in a changing magnetic field, there is an induced electromotive force or EMF that is generated in the conductor. Here's an example of how one works. 1) The coil in the cooktop generates a magnetic field. 2) A piece of iron or steel … WebHá 1 dia · Induction motors are a type of AC motor invented in the late 1800s, and they are a practical application of the science of electromagnetism. These motors consist of stators and rotors, which are the stationary and rotational motor components, respectively. The stator - the motor housing - contains windings of wire connected to an AC power ...

It is called … WebA synchronous motor is one in which the rotor normally rotates at the same speed as the revolving field in the machine. The stator is similar to that of an induction machine consisting of a cylindrical iron frame with windings, usually three-phase, located in slots around the inner periphery. The difference is in the rotor, which normally contains an …

WebTesla's AC motor was groundbreaking. With its three main parts: a rotor, a stator and coils, this clever new system would convert electrical energy into mechanical energy with the use of the electro magnetic induction, i.e. magnetic field was being created with the use of alternating current. Turning current into motion had never been done more efficiently before.
